Editor: So, here we have "In the Garden," painted by Ipolit Strâmbu around 1930. It's an oil painting, a portrait of a woman in a wide-brimmed hat. It feels... serene, almost wistful. What do you see in this piece? Curator: What immediately strikes me is how this portrait speaks to the evolving roles of women in the early 20th century. The subject’s gaze isn't directly engaging; she seems lost in thought, subtly challenging the male gaze that dominated portraiture for so long. Do you think that’s a fair interpretation? Editor: I hadn't considered that. It does seem like she's asserting her own space and perspective, separate from any observer. How does the Impressionist style contribute to this effect? Curator: The soft brushstrokes and the focus on light and color serve to de-emphasize rigid definition. It softens the woman's image, almost blurring the boundaries between her individual identity and the environment. This can be read as a visual metaphor for the breaking down of traditional societal constraints. Look at how the light falls on her face versus how her face remains partially shadowed. What might that mean? Editor: It could suggest that even within a rapidly changing world, elements of oppression or social expectation linger. Curator: Precisely! And her red necklace? A flash of color that hints at her vibrancy, her potential to resist, to step out of those shadows. How might we contextualize this painting within larger debates about gender, representation, and agency in the interwar period?
